For the first quarter of 2026, management expects revenues in the range of $800M and $830M and a gross profit margin in the range of 19.9% +/- 50 basis points, including the negative impact of approximately 50 to 75 basis points related to Newport.

About VSH
Vishay Intertechnology, Inc. is engaged in manufacturing a portfolio of discrete semiconductors and passive electronic components, which supports designs in the automotive, industrial, computing, consumer, telecommunications, military, aerospace, and medical markets. The Company manufactures and markets electronic components that cover a range of functions and technologies. The Company’s products include commodity, non-commodity, and custom products. Its brands include Siliconix, Dale, Draloric, Beyschlag, Sfernice, MCB, UltraSource, Applied Thin-Film Products, IHLP, HiRel Systems, Sprague, Vitramon, Barry, Roederstein, ESTA, BCcomponents, and Ametherm. Its semiconductor products include metal oxide semiconductor field-effect transistors (MOSFETs), diodes, and optoelectronic components. Its semiconductor components are used for a variety of functions, including switching, amplifying, rectifying, routing, or transmitting electrical signals, power conversion, and power management.

- Product Innovation: Vishay's newly launched VODA1275 automotive-grade MOSFET driver features an 8 mm creepage distance and a comparative tracking index (CTI) of 600 in a compact SMD-4 package, significantly enhancing safety and reliability in high-voltage automotive applications.
- Performance Advantage: The driver delivers a typical open circuit voltage of 20 V, a short circuit current of 20 μA, and a turn-on time of just 80 μs, which is three times faster than competing devices, enabling quicker and more reliable driving of MOSFETs and IGBTs in high-voltage systems.
- Design Simplification: With its high open circuit output voltage, the VODA1275 allows designers to use only one driver instead of two in 800 V+ battery systems, saving space and reducing costs, making it ideal for pre-charge circuits and battery management systems in electric and hybrid vehicles.
- Environmental Compliance: The driver is RoHS-compliant, halogen-free, and classified as Vishay Green, enhancing its market competitiveness in modern automotive designs while meeting the demand for environmentally friendly materials.

- High Precision Performance: Vishay's newly launched Sfernice40 LHE linear position sensor utilizes non-contact Hall Effect technology, achieving linearity of ±1% and a resolution of 12 µm, with a lifespan exceeding 10 million cycles, making it ideal for high-precision servo control systems.
- Expanded Application Range: The sensor extends electrical stroke capability from 10 mm to 40 mm, suitable for infrastructure monitoring, digital farming, industrial automation, and medical robotics, significantly enhancing small displacement monitoring capabilities across various sectors.
- Durability Design: The 40 LHE features an IP67 rating, capable of withstanding high-frequency vibrations up to 20 g and shocks up to 50 g, while integrated reverse voltage and overvoltage protections reduce the need for external circuitry, thereby lowering costs.
- Simplified Integration: This device offers both analog and digital output signals, supports flexible horizontal or vertical mounting, and reports its position immediately upon power-up without requiring recalibration or initialization, further reducing the need for battery backup.

- Long-Term Revenue Growth Disappoints: Vishay Intertechnology's annualized revenue growth of only 4.2% over the past five years falls short of semiconductor industry standards, indicating poor long-term performance that may undermine investor confidence.
- Low Gross Margin: The company's average gross margin of 20.3% over the last two years means it pays $79.67 to suppliers for every $100 in revenue, reflecting a lack of pricing power in a highly competitive market, which negatively impacts profitability.
- Cash Burn Ignites Concerns: While the company reported positive free cash flow this quarter, its average free cash flow margin of negative 3.8% over the past two years suggests that high reinvestment demands have strained resources, limiting its ability to return capital to investors.
- High Market Valuation: Trading at $16.66 per share with a forward P/E of 30.3, Vishay Intertechnology appears overvalued, as analysts believe other companies currently exhibit superior fundamentals, advising investors to proceed with caution.

- Product Launch: Vishay Intertechnology's newly introduced SGCM05339 space-grade common mode choke is specifically designed for aerospace and defense applications, featuring a high thermal rating current capability of up to 14.43 A, ensuring reliable performance in extreme environments and meeting market demands for efficient EMI filtering and noise suppression.
- Technical Specifications: The device utilizes a robust nanocrystalline core and overmolded construction, offering inductance values ranging from 320 µH to 10,400 µH and common mode impedance from 540 Ω to 3600 Ω, capable of stable operation across a wide temperature range of -55 °C to +130 °C, suitable for various applications.
- Compliance and Customization: The SGCM05339 is outgassing compliant per ASTM-E595 and offers a variety of screening options, including MIL-PRF-27 and MIL-STD-981, allowing for customization based on customer requirements, thereby enhancing its market competitiveness.
- Market Availability and Delivery: Samples and production quantities of the new product are available now with lead times of 8 to 12 weeks, further solidifying Vishay's leadership position in the global market with its extensive portfolio of discrete semiconductors and passive electronic components.

- Product Specification Highlights: Vishay's newly launched tricolor LED provides a luminous intensity of 252 mcd at 5 mA, housed in a compact 1.0 mm by 1.0 mm by 0.65 mm 0404 surface-mount package, enabling individual control for RGB displays and backlighting across various applications.
- Technological Advantages: Utilizing the latest high-brightness AllnGaP and InGaN technologies, this LED is 70% smaller than the PLCC-4, excelling in micro-mobility, energy storage, and industrial applications, suitable for status indicators and dashboard signal illumination.
- Reliability and Compatibility: The VLMRGB1500 offers high reliability over a temperature range from -40°C to +85°C, is RoHS compliant, withstands ESD voltages up to 2 kV, and is fully compatible with competing devices, allowing for direct replacements without PCB modifications.
- Market Availability: Samples and production quantities of the product are currently available with lead times of 17 weeks, as Vishay provides a vast portfolio of discrete semiconductors and passive electronic components for automotive, industrial, and consumer markets worldwide.

- High-Performance Optocouplers: Vishay's new VOx619A series phototransistor optocouplers maintain over 75% linear current transfer ratio (CTR) at temperatures up to +125°C, while reducing forward current by 50% to 0.5 mA, significantly enhancing energy efficiency and signal fidelity in industrial applications.
- Diverse Packaging Options: The series offers four packaging choices, including DIL-4, LSOP-4, SOP-4, and SSOP-4, catering to various application needs, particularly in micro mobility, industrial, and telecom sectors, ensuring reliable performance under extreme conditions.
- Enhanced Electrical Isolation: The DIL-4 and LSOP-4 packages feature a maximum isolation voltage of 5000 VRMS, ensuring safe signal transmission in power supplies and programmable controllers, while the SOP-4 and SSOP-4 provide 3750 VRMS isolation, suitable for space-constrained designs.
- Market Availability and Outlook: Samples and production quantities of the VOx619A series are now available with an eight-week lead time, as Vishay continues to hold a significant position in automotive, industrial, and consumer electronics markets with its extensive portfolio of discrete semiconductors and passive electronic components.
